Automatic mechanistic inference from large families of Boolean models generated by Monte Carlo Tree Search

Abstract: Many important processes in biology, such as signaling and gene regulation, can be described using logic models. These logic models are typically built to behaviorally emulate experimentally observed phenotypes, which are assumed to be steady states of a biological system. Most models are built by hand and therefore researchers are only able to consider one or perhaps a few potential mechanisms.
